2. Important Materials
The material of your resort dress makes a big difference in how it feels and looks.
- Cotton: Cotton is a natural fiber. It’s soft, breathable, and great for hot weather. It’s also easy to wash.
- Linen: Linen is another natural fabric. It’s very light and breathable, making it perfect for the heat. It has a relaxed, slightly crinkled look that’s stylish.
- Rayon (Viscose): Rayon is a man-made fabric that comes from wood pulp. It drapes well and feels soft. It often looks a bit like silk.
- Chiffon: Chiffon is a very light and sheer fabric. It’s flowy and elegant. Dresses made of chiffon are often layered or have lining for modesty.
3.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ality
Some things make a resort dress last longer and look better. Others can make it fall apart quickly.
- Good Stitching: Look for neat, strong stitches. Loose threads or uneven seams can mean the dress won’t hold up well.
- Durable Fabric: High-quality fabrics resist pilling (those little balls that form on clothes) and fading.
- Thoughtful Design: Details like well-placed buttons, secure zippers, and reinforced seams add to the quality.
- Cheap Materials: If a fabric feels stiff or rough, it might not be good quality. It might also snag or tear easily.
- Poor Construction: A dress that feels like it’s falling apart after one wash isn’t a good buy.

Frequently Asked Questions About Resort Dresses
Q: What is the best material for a resort dress?
A: Cotton and linen are excellent choices because they are breathable and comfortable in warm weather. Rayon is also a good option for its soft feel.
Q: How do I know if a resort dress is good quality?
A: Look for neat stitching and durable fabric that feels soft and not stiff. Well-made details also show good quality.
Q: Can I wear a resort dress to dinner?
A: Yes! Many resort dresses are versatile. A maxi dress or a dress with a slightly dressier fabric can easily be worn to dinner with the right accessories.
Q: How should I pack my resort dress?
A: Choose dresses made from fabrics that don’t wrinkle easily, like cotton blends or rayon. You can often roll them up to save space in your suitcase.
Q: What makes a resort dress “resort-appropriate”?
A: Resort dresses are typically lightweight, breathable, and have a relaxed, vacation-ready style. They are designed for warm climates and casual settings.
Q: Should I buy a long or short resort dress?
A: This depends on your preference and where you plan to wear it. Maxi dresses are great for evenings, while shorter sundresses are perfect for daytime.
Q: How do I care for my resort dress?
A: Always check the care label. Many resort dresses can be hand-washed or machine-washed on a gentle cycle with cold water.
Q: What kind of shoes go well with resort dresses?
A: Sandals, flip-flops, espadrilles, and even white sneakers can look great with resort dresses.
Q: Are resort dresses only for vacations?
A: While they are perfect for vacations, you can also wear them during warm weather in your hometown for casual outings or summer events.
Q: What are some common styles of resort dresses?
A: Popular styles include maxi dresses, sundresses, slip dresses, and tunic dresses. They often feature bright colors, fun prints, or flowy silhouettes.
